Suggestion for readers who have an interest in checking out the topic further

For readers intrigued by the secrets of the afterlife, "Is Death The Final Destination?: A Glimpse of The Afterlife" by John White is a fascinating read that explores profound concerns. To even more explore this thought-provoking topic, think about diving into homepage works like "Life After Life" by Raymond Moody and "The Tibetan Book of Living and Dying" by Sogyal Rinpoche.

These books use diverse perspectives on what lies beyond our earthly presence, enhancing your understanding of the afterlife. Additionally, exploring Near-Death Experience (NDE) accounts shared in get more information books such as "Proof of Heaven" by Eben Alexander can supply interesting insights into the potential extension of awareness post-death.
